Nigeria’s Super Eagles on Monday night drubbed Mozambique by four goals to nothing in their 2025 African Cup Of Nations (AFCON) Round Of 16 match.
The Nigerian team showed why they’re called Super Eagles, right from the blast of the whistle, as Ademola Lookman opened scoring for them in about quarter hour mark, and went ahead to give an assist that paved way for Victor Osimhen’s goal to give the Eagles a 2-0 lead in the first half.
There were near misses from the Eagles side, while Mozambique tried to break the Nigerian domination. The fight half ended with Nigeria Leading by 2-0.
Barely two minutes into the second half, Lookman broke through from the left flank, sends a finished pass to Osimhen who needed just a tap-in for his second goal on the night, that gives Nigeria a deserved 3-0 lead.
The game went on with lots of hard tackles that produced some deserved yellow cards to Wilfred Ndidi and Onyeka, while defence trojan Bassey was also booked.
Akor, who fed Lookman for the first goal, finally registered his name amongst the scorers of the night, making Nigeria’s goals 4-0 to earn a quarter final ticket.
